// Fixture: donation-receipt mailer, Givenshaw nonprofit tier.
// Covers: receipt generation, currency rounding, and the annual
// summary batch. Reviewer notes: the mailer stub intercepts SMTP,
// so nothing actually sends. Amounts use integer cents — the
// rounding test exists because of the Harvestpool incident, don't
// remove it. The receipt-render service mock requires auth on
// every call; the fixture setup authenticates against it with the
// bearer token below.

session JWT of yawep-yawep = eyJhbGciOiJIUzI1NiIsInR5cCI6IkpXVCJ9.eyJzdWIiOiI3pWF3_In0.aXYsHiog

Subject: DR drill — FareLogic rules engine

As part of Thursday's disaster-recovery drill, we will restore the FareLogic shipping-fee rules engine from the offsite snapshot and replay the last 24 hours of rate changes. Please observe the restore of the encrypted rule store. The vault unlock requires the recovery passphrase noted directly below.

vault phrase of bafop-kahop = sormir-frador

# Donation-receipt mailer (Givlet) — read this before touching anything.
# The mailer batches receipts every 15 minutes; if on-call gets paged for
# stuck receipts, check the outbox table first — it's almost always a
# provider timeout, not our queue. Retries cap at 5, then items park in
# the hold state for manual release. Don't bump the batch size past 200;
# the provider throttles us hard. The mailer won't start without its
# provider credential, which lives on the next line:

env line for fafof-fahag: LEDGER_TOKEN5=f8790